The Shark Robot Vacuum and Mop Self-Emptying XL RV1001AE

This two-in-one robot vacuums and mops exceptionally well on carpet and floors that are not bare. It can be controlled using the physical Clean and Dock button on its top, or the SharkClean App, or with voice commands using Alexa or Google Assistant.

It also has good obstacle avoidance, which the more expensive iRobot Roomba i7+ lacks. However the dustbin needs frequent emptying, and isn't as clean as other self-emptying models.

The Shark EZ Robot Self-Empty is considered to be one of the best robot vacuums for tile and carpet floors because it offers an effective, high-efficiency, powerful vacuum with a HEPA bagless mop. It also comes with some automation features that reduce the necessity for manual maintenance. For example, when it's done cleaning, ready to empty or charged the robot will return to its dock. As opposed to other robot vacuums, it doesn't have a remote, but you can control it using the physical Clean and Dock buttons on top, or by using your smartphone or voice commands with Amazon Alexa or Google Assistant.

Another great feature is the ability to create schedules for this Shark robot vacuum and mop. The app allows you to create an appointment for any day and set the exact time when the machine will start working. In our tests, the robot kept to all the scheduled tasks that we had created and began working at the time we set it.

As with the other shark self empty vacuum vacuums and mops model uses a combo of the sonic vibration as well as cleaning solution to clean your floors. The mopping pads move around the floor to collect dirt and other debris that could otherwise be left behind by other robotic mop. In our tests it was able lift minor to moderate stains from bathroom tile and kitchen laminate flooring.

We also appreciate the fact that it doesn't come with a trash bin that must be empty manually after each use. It's a small touch, but it helps to cut down on the number of times you'll need to empty the bin throughout the lifespan of your robot. The only drawback of this vacuum and mop combo is that it doesn't come with an actual obstacle avoidance feature like the pricier Shark AI Ultra Robot.

The Shark robot comes with additional features that make it an excellent purchase. For instance, it has three suction power modes which are normal, Eco, and Max. It also has two side brushes that allow it to move more easily over obstacles like electrical cords.

Mapping

The Shark IQ Robot Self-Emptying XL RV1001AE ($599) is one of the best two-in-one robot vacuums we've evaluated. It is fast and efficient, it is rarely stuck and has a large bin at its base station which can be empty every month. You can also manage it via your phone or voice commands and set cleaning schedules to do the work for you.

Like many other Shark products, this model has a 360-degree LIDAR sensor that creates an accurate map of your home so it can move around without bumping into obstacles even at night. The app allows you to create custom carpet and no-go zones and to adjust cleaning schedules at any time.

Shark is a manufacturer of kitchen appliances and household cleaners under its brand name Ninja has rapidly caught up with its rivals. The company has a wide range of inexpensive robots with numerous features that can be used for a variety of uses.

The EZ Self-Eliminating Robot Vacuum is distinguished with a number of characteristics, including a large dirt compartment, which is located on the charging dock. It also comes with a powerful suction that can effortlessly handle floors with no floor and low and high-pile carpet. It can be controlled by physical 'Clean' and 'Dock buttons on top, or through the SharkClean app and Alexa or Google Assistant voice commands. Its battery can last for around 70 minutes in its "Max power mode' and comes with indicator lights to show when it's close to running out of juice.

The Shark IQ has some advantages over the EZ Self-Emptying Robot, the most especially its LIDAR mapping system that provides more precise room scanning and the ability to recognize common household objects as obstacles that it can overcome. It has a stronger motor and is more movable. It also performs better on unfinished floors. The EZ is, however, equipped with more features, is charged faster and is less likely be stuck on rug tassels and has lower costs for recurring expenses.

Performance

The Shark IQ robot is a great choice for vacuuming and mops. It removes a significant amount of debris from bare floors and is able to do a good job on carpeted areas and feels solidly constructed. It does have a plasticky feeling and isn't as well-equipped as other robots of its price in terms of features that enhance quality of life.

It has only three power settings that include the energy-saving "Eco" mode, as well as the default "Normal" mode. You can only switch between these modes in the companion application when the appliance is running. It does not have a vacuum Only mode, as well as a mopping only cycle. It does have a side brush that is able to be switched off or on however. Its vacuuming capabilities are solid, but it does struggle to get rid of bulky materials such as rice, which could cause it to overflow its dirt compartment and cause clogging.

The mopping efficiency, however is impressive, thanks to its thorough pathing and mopping system that uses Sonic. The cleaning cycle can run for up to 90 minutes and the tank can hold up to 2 gallons water and mopping solution. The mopping pad is also reusable.

The IQ's maneuverability is good, though it does get stuck at times on low-lying obstructions like rug tassels or electrical cords. Its sensor-based navigation uses infrared sensors and LiDAR to navigate, but it can sometimes misidentify the location of my cat's condo as an escalator. It can be manually controlled by using the SharkClean app and through voice control via Amazon Alexa or Google Assistant. The top surface is equipped with a set of indicator lights that give an approximate estimation of the remaining battery's life.
